If you really want to learn to PvP find a lowsec corp - either a Faction Warfare corporation or a pirate corporation - you'll learn far more about ship-to-ship PvP (as suppose to giant capital fights or boring structure shoots).

In lowsec, not having to worry about spies and not having to deal with Sov maintenance means there is a lot less political interference, and a lot more regular fighting.

Every PvP corp that's worth anything will involve a bit of hazing and waiting - you may have to fight alongside the corp you want to join a bit before they'll accept you, but its still possible to get on board if you show that you're serious.

Alliance requirements for fleets are often quite cookie cutter - and you'll learn quickly how to take orders but it will be harder in the long run to learn to think for yourself in a PvP engagement.

Low sec PvP is a bit steeper to get into, because more individual thinking is required out of each pilot in the gang, but the skill level can often exceed that of Alliance pilots who, like I said, are used to reliance on prescribed fits and following strict orders.

So yeah, those are your two options. If an alliance will actually take you, you might have a bit of an easier time since you can become a cog in the machine pretty quickly and might receive more easy-to-learn instruction upfront. But if you seek out PvP training in nullsec - the learning curve will be steeper but you'll turn out a better pilot in the long run - because you'll learn how to fight a much wider variety of ships than you'd find in nullsec.

Experienced low sec FC's know how to use all the ship types that "X up" for a roam - and will most certainly have a place for your caldari training. The main problem with Caldari is that shields don't scale well with massive fleet engagements - once you're at the battleship level armor tanking is the norm. Thus, the alliances won't have much patience for you bringing an off-tank ship to a fleet. However, in lowsec, roaming gangs of frigates, cruisers, and battlecruisers are commonplace, and ships such as Tengu's, Drakes, Blackbirds, Falcons, Naga's, and Hookbill's are used with deadly effect.

Ultimately you'll just have to decide which fleet size / challenge level you want to begin learning PvP at. I always prefer smaller fleet work myself, because victory revolves more around which gang exhibits greater talent, as supposed to which superpower shows up with greater numbers.

Don't be fooled into thinking that 0.0 is the ultimate destination for PvP. It's just the ultimate destination for one kind of PvP.

Also, anyone telling you that you must sell your toon because you trained Caldari and want to PvP has no idea what they are talking about. If you love Caldari ships, there is a corp and an FC that will use you. I guarantee it.

You should learn a tackler t2 frigate or faction frigate. It's just a few weeks. Tacklers are needed everywhere and they fit in every fleet composition. After that you should give another try to join a corp. As a second step guardian and scimitar. Everybody loves logi pilots and in most of the null corps usually they have ship reimbursement programm on those ships so flying those things is healthy for your wallet too.
